Description
Former farmhouse dating from the late 18th century. It is constructed of brick and has a plain tiled roof. The building is two storeys high and consists of four bays, with an additional bay to the right that features a six-panelled doorway. This doorway is set beneath an openwork timber gabled porch, which has brick footing walls and turned shafts. The windows on either side of the doorway are 3-light casements, although the ones to the left of the doorway are blind. All openings have cambered brick heads. There is a wing at the rear and a range of outbuildings that form part of the property.
